I graduated cum laude from the University of Florida in 2004 with a Bachelor of Science in Business Management. I later obtained my law degree from the University of Florida, Levin College of Law in December of 2007, and was admitted the practice law in Georgia in 2008.
During my time in law school, I participated as a Children's Fellow through the Center on Children and Families. I later developed my passion for family law by volunteering at a domestic violence clinic and a pro se divorce clinic, before working in private practice.
I have exclusively practiced family law since obtaining my bar membership in the State of Georgia. Before joining my current firm, Stern & Edlin, I practiced family law at the Law Offices of Pamela L. Tremayne, and at Callner, Portnoy & Strawser, P.C.
I am very passionate about practicing family law and I believe in providing support, understanding, advocacy and counseling to each client.
